When it comes to pallet racking, flow storage is essential for managing perishable, time-sensitive products on a first in/first out (FIFO) basis. Since the design eliminates aisles and fills the space with additional pallets, it provides more storage than a selective rack. In addition, forklift travel is greatly reduced because drivers only need to place and retrieve loads from either end of the system, significantly reducing operating costs, maintenance and accidents. Better space utilization also minimizes the need to light, heat and cool the facility, further decreasing expenses.
